logo

DeepSeek联网问答API:轻量化实时交互技术深度解析

作者:渣渣辉2025.09.25 15:36浏览量:0

简介:本文聚焦DeepSeek联网问答公开API接口,深入探讨其轻量级架构设计、实时响应机制及技术实现细节,为开发者提供从基础原理到实践优化的全链路指导。

一、轻量级API接口的技术定位与价值

在智能问答场景中,传统API接口常面临高延迟、高资源消耗、复杂场景适配困难三大痛点。DeepSeek联网问答API通过轻量化设计突破这一瓶颈,其核心价值体现在三个方面:

  1. 资源效率优化
    采用分层压缩算法,将请求/响应数据包体积压缩至传统接口的30%-50%。例如,用户输入”2024年诺贝尔物理学奖得主”的原始请求数据为2.1KB,经压缩后仅需680B,显著降低网络传输开销。
  2. 实时性保障机制
    构建三级响应加速体系:
    • 边缘计算节点:在全球部署200+边缘节点,实现90%请求的本地化处理
    • 智能路由算法:动态选择最优传输路径,端到端延迟稳定在120ms以内
    • 增量更新技术:对长文本问答采用分块传输,首包响应时间缩短至85ms
  3. 场景自适应能力
    通过配置化参数实现三档性能模式切换:
    1. # 性能模式配置示例
    2. config = {
    3. "response_mode": "fast", # 极速模式(牺牲部分准确率)
    4. "cache_level": 2, # 二级缓存(平衡速度与新鲜度)
    5. "compression": True # 启用数据压缩
    6. }

二、核心技术架构解析

1. 请求处理流水线

采用五阶段异步处理架构:

  1. 预处理层
    • 文本规范化(统一大小写、标点处理)
    • 意图分类(基于BERT微调模型,准确率98.7%)
  2. 检索层
    • 多模态检索引擎支持文本/图片/语音混合查询
    • 动态索引更新机制(每15分钟同步一次知识库)
  3. 推理层
    • 轻量级LLM模型(参数量3.2B,推理速度比GPT-3.5快4倍)
    • 注意力机制优化(稀疏注意力降低计算复杂度)
  4. 后处理层
    • 答案润色(语法检查、冗余信息过滤)
    • 多版本生成(提供简洁/详细/学术三种回答风格)
  5. 传输层
    • QUIC协议支持(减少握手延迟)
    • 自适应码率控制(根据网络状况动态调整)

2. 关键技术突破

动态知识图谱融合

构建双层知识表示模型

  • 静态知识层:结构化知识图谱(10亿+实体关系)
  • 动态知识层:实时网页抓取+时效性验证模块
    当用户询问”今日黄金价格”时,系统会:
  1. 从知识图谱获取基础计价单位
  2. 通过实时爬虫获取最新市场数据
  3. 交叉验证3个以上权威来源
  4. 生成带时间戳的响应:”截至2024年3月15日14:00,上海黄金交易所AU9999报价为512.30元/克”

轻量级模型优化

采用三阶段模型压缩技术:

  1. 知识蒸馏:将175B参数大模型的知识迁移到3.2B模型
  2. 量化训练:使用INT8量化将模型体积缩小75%
  3. 结构化剪枝:移除90%的低权重连接
    实测显示,在CPU环境下推理速度提升8倍,而准确率仅下降2.3个百分点。

三、开发者实践指南

1. 快速集成方案

RESTful API调用示例

  1. import requests
  2. url = "https://api.deepseek.com/v1/qa"
  3. headers = {
  4. "Authorization": "Bearer YOUR_API_KEY",
  5. "Content-Type": "application/json"
  6. }
  7. data = {
  8. "question": "量子计算的发展现状",
  9. "context": None, # 可选上下文
  10. "parameters": {
  11. "response_length": "medium",
  12. "temperature": 0.7
  13. }
  14. }
  15. response = requests.post(url, headers=headers, json=data)
  16. print(response.json())

WebSocket实时流示例

  1. const socket = new WebSocket("wss://api.deepseek.com/v1/ws/qa");
  2. socket.onopen = () => {
  3. socket.send(JSON.stringify({
  4. type: "init",
  5. api_key: "YOUR_API_KEY"
  6. }));
  7. };
  8. socket.onmessage = (event) => {
  9. const data = JSON.parse(event.data);
  10. if (data.type === "chunk") {
  11. processChunk(data.content); // 实时处理分块数据
  12. }
  13. };

2. 性能优化策略

缓存机制设计

建议采用三级缓存体系

  1. 客户端缓存:LocalStorage存储高频问题(TTL=1小时)
  2. 代理层缓存:Nginx缓存静态答案(TTL=10分钟)
  3. 服务端缓存:Redis存储动态答案(TTL=5分钟)
    实测显示,缓存命中率提升至65%时,QPS可增加3倍。

错误处理最佳实践

  1. def handle_api_response(response):
  2. if response.status_code == 429:
  3. # 触发退避算法
  4. wait_time = min(2**retry_count, 30)
  5. time.sleep(wait_time)
  6. elif response.status_code == 503:
  7. # 切换备用API端点
  8. switch_to_backup_endpoint()
  9. else:
  10. try:
  11. return response.json()
  12. except ValueError:
  13. log_error("Invalid JSON response")

四、典型应用场景

1. 智能客服系统

某电商平台集成后实现:

  • 平均响应时间从45秒降至1.2秒
  • 人工客服介入率下降72%
  • 问答准确率提升至91.3%

2. 实时数据查询

金融行业应用案例:

  • 股票行情查询延迟<200ms
  • 支持每秒500+并发请求
  • 数据源可信度评分系统(0-10分)

3. 移动端轻应用

在资源受限设备上的表现:

  • Android低端机(骁龙660)首屏加载<1.5秒
  • 内存占用稳定在45MB以下
  • 离线模式支持基础问答功能

五、未来演进方向

  1. 多模态交互升级:2024年Q3将支持语音+手势的复合查询
  2. 隐私保护增强:引入同态加密技术,实现密文状态下的问答处理
  3. 自适应学习系统:通过强化学习动态优化回答策略
  4. 行业垂直模型:推出金融/医疗/法律等领域的专用API版本

结语:DeepSeek联网问答API通过轻量化设计、实时响应能力和场景自适应特性,重新定义了智能问答接口的技术标准。开发者可通过灵活的参数配置和高效的集成方案,快速构建满足业务需求的智能问答系统。随着5G和边缘计算的普及,这类轻量级API将成为AI服务落地的重要基础设施。

相关文章推荐

发表评论